  1. Sep 14, 2019 · Preheat oven to 350F. Slice green and yellow zuchini, eggplant and roma tomatoes into 1/4 inch sliced round meddalions. Try to make all the slices the same width. Mix the can of diced tomatoes with the onion and garlic. Spread the mixture evenly across the bottom of a medium sized casserole or baking dish.

  3. Jul 23, 2021 · Instructions. Preheat oven to 425°F. Cut all the vegetables (eggplant, zucchini, bell pepper, tomatoes, onions) so that they are approximately the same size and can cook evenly. Transfer them on a large rimmed baking tray. Add the garlic and herbs (thyme, bay leaves, and rosemary (optional). Sprinkle enough salt, pepper, and olive oil to ...

  6. Nov 8, 2021 · Spread 1 Tbsp olive oil in the bottom of a 9 inch cast iron skillet**. In a small bowl, mix the crushed tomatoes, tomato paste, onion, garlic, thyme, salt and pepper. Pour the mixture into the base of your skillet. Layer the sliced vegetables vertically around the skillet, packing them as tight as you can.
